Quote:
Originally Posted by boostinallovryou View Post
You are partially correct. Pop N 1 - 3 ran on DJ Main hardware. That has a 2.5" (laptop) hard drive. CHD's are easily created off those drives. Pop N 4 - 8 ran on Firebeat hardware. That system uses 1 CDROM and 1DVDROM. No hard disks. Again CHD's are easy to create off those. Pop N 9 - 13 ran on Viper hardware. Uses a Compact Flash card. DVDROM is still used to load up the CF card. Pop N 14 - current is on Bemani PS2 hardware. DVD used again.

The point was that you might not be interested in bringing this to MAME but other people are. I think you might be confusing Pop N and IIDX when it comes to hard drive images running under windows. IIDX uses embedded windows, not Pop N. Like I mentioned above 14 - current uses a PS2 with an external hardware interface.

I just wanted to ask the community if anybody out there had disks so we can document and preserve a great game line. That's what this forum is for right?
You are obviously misinformed. 9-14 uses bemani viper ps2 hardware, and as of pop'n 15, they switched to bemanipc which is embedded windows ala IIDX. With hard drives.

source: I bought a freaking cabinet.
